Important Information for Potential Applicants Using the Council’s Website.
Application Forms – Application forms and Job Descriptions are available from the Head of Personnel at the Townhall, Enniskillen or they can be downloaded from this website; alternatively applicants can complete and submit our online application form.
The layout of the Application Form must not be amended under any circumstances.
You should include sufficient information in your application to demonstrate how, and to what extent you meet the requirements of the job. The Appointments Panel can only take account of the information which you provide on your application form.
Application Forms submitted by post should be returned in an envelope clearly marked APPLICATION FORM to the Chief Executive, Fermanagh District Council, Townhall, Enniskillen, Co Fermanagh, BT74 7BA – completed applications will not be accepted by e-mail.
CVs – Please note that CVs will not be considered.
Closing Dates – Completed application forms must be returned before the established closing date. Applications received after the closing date will not be considered.
Eligibility for Working in the UK – All short-listed candidates must be able to satisfy the Appointments Panel that they are eligible to apply for work within the UK.
Fermanagh District Council is an Equal Opportunities employer and welcomes applications from all sections of the community. If you have a disability and have any difficulty in the course of the recruitment process, please feel free to contact us (028) 6632 5050 to discuss reasonable adjustments to our process.

Each Application Pack will comprise:
1) The Job Description
2) The Personnel Specification
3) The Application Form and Fair Employment Monitoring Statement.
